Am I the Asshole for offering my son’s girlfriend money?

I am a very wealthy man. As the owner of a huge corporation that deals with everything from farming, to construction, to warehousing, I am considered one of the elite members of society. I have an adult son, Danny, who is keen to make his way in the world, and my wife has a teenaged daughter who is still in school. We live a very comfortable life.

Danny, 21m, is wealthy, good looking, intelligent, well educated. He has all the attributes that will make him a successful man. But he insists on wasting his time with an insignificant casher girl from Gromdon. This girl, Gemma, comes from nothing. She has no money, no citizenship, no education. I highly doubt she can read, write, or hold an intelligent conversation. This may sound crass, but I’m certain this girl can only provide my son with one thing… and that is something he can get for free from countless other high-class women, who have something else to offer besides what is between their legs.

I’m so ashamed. My son is worth more than this. I’ve discussed it with him, and tried to make him see this girl is using him for his wealth and his citizen status, but he tells me they love each other. I don’t know how, but this girl has her claws stuck into my son, and he is delusional, thinking she cares for him, and not for what is in his wallet.

Since I was getting nowhere by speaking to Danny, I arranged to meet with Gemma. The state of her when she arrived at my office was enough to fill me with disgust. What he sees in a woman who cannot afford a decent pair of shoes, or a hairbrush is beyond me.

I care for my son’s safety and his wellbeing. I do not want to see him used or hurt by some gold-digging whore who is out for all she can get. My son could have his pick of women. What is so special about one with no prospects? Wealthy elite only stay that way by following the rules of the elite circle. Matches are supposed to be beneficial for both families, and resources are meant to expand. This girl can bring nothing to the table, and in reality, I foresee her depleting our fortune and decreasing our prestigious place in society.

The girl is obviously desperate for money and basic amenities. Cashers have no right to electricity or clean running water. They do not drive, and they cannot own cell phones. It is even illegal for them to rent properties. So, I offered her more money than she could possibly know what to do with. $10,000. That would be an absolute fortune to her, more money than she will ever see in her entire lifetime.

I was certain she would jump at the chance to line her pockets. My only stipulation was that she needed to cut ties with my son. Leave him alone and live her life, and allow him to reach his full potential, without being held back by some desperate beggar.

Of course, Gemma declined the money. You may think that perhaps I am mistaken, and she really does love my son, but I know better. This girl is smarter than I gave her credit for. She is in it for the long game, and I believe she is holding out for marriage. If she marries into my family, she will become a legal citizen of New America, and she will automatically be entitled to half of Danny’s fortune.

She said I was a despicable person, and now I am afraid that she will tell Danny that I tried to bribe her to leave him. The way she will twist it will make me look terrible, but I promise, I only have my son’s interests at heart. AITA?
